August 2026 is shaping up to be an extraordinary month for astronomy enthusiasts.
2026年8月對天文愛好者而言,將是極其不凡的一個月份。
Astronomers are preparing for a busy schedule of celestial events that promise to fascinate both professionals and amateur stargazers alike.
天文學家們正準備迎接一連串繁忙的天文事件,這些事件保證能讓專業人士與業餘觀星者都感到著迷。
The highlight of the month is the total solar eclipse on August 12, which will trace a path of totality across parts of Europe, offering a unique opportunity for vital heliophysics research.
本月最受矚目的焦點是8月12日的日全食,這場日全食的路徑將橫跨歐洲部分地區,為重要的日物理學研究提供絕佳機會。
Simultaneously, the Perseid meteor shower will reach its peak on August 12 and 13.
與此同時,英仙座流星雨將在8月12日與13日達到高峰。
Thanks to the favorable timing of a new moon, observers can expect exceptionally dark, clear skies, making this one of the most visible meteor displays in years.
多虧了新月期間的有利時機,觀測者將能期待極為漆黑且清晰的天空,這使此次成為近年來最清晰可見的流星雨之一。
In addition to the eclipse and meteor shower, mid-August features a spectacular planetary parade.
除了日食與流星雨外,8月中旬還有一場壯觀的行星連珠。
Mars, Jupiter, Saturn, Mercury, Uranus, and Neptune will align in the pre-dawn sky.
火星、木星、土星、水星、天王星與海王星將在黎明前的天空中排列成一線。
Later in the month, a partial lunar eclipse on August 27 and 28 will grace the skies over North America.
隨後在8月27日與28日,一場月偏食將掠過北美洲上空。
From the appearance of Comet 10P/Tempel to the bright visibility of Venus at its greatest elongation, August 2026 offers a rare convergence of cosmic phenomena that reminds us of the wonders awaiting us in the night sky.
從10P/Tempel彗星的出現,到金星以最大離角呈現明亮身影,2026年8月提供了一場罕見的宇宙現象匯集,提醒著我們夜空中等待著我們的諸多奇蹟。
